Grundfos RC

Posted by on Thursday, 23 April, 2015

Grundfos RC pumps are used for the circulation of liquid refrigerants in refrigeration systems.

 

The RC pumps have been designed and optimised for use with CO2 as a refrigerant, but can also be used with NH3 (Ammonia) and selected HFCs.

 

 

The low required NPSH and the fact that no traditional loss-generating protective devices are needed can help system designers to reduce the dimensions and cost of the system. The RC pumps have an innovative design in stainless steel which makes specially suited for use with high pressure refrigerants (CO2) – the pump has only one seal between the refrigerant and ambient sides. A version with welded connections eliminates the use of counter flanges and possible leakage in flange connections.

Applications

Grundfos RC pumps are designed for the circulation of liquid refrigerant in refrigeration systems.

Features and benefits

  • Barrel-type, semi-hermetic, high-pressure design
  • Multistage centrifugal pump
  • Canned motor (no shaft seals)
  • High energy efficiency
  • Wide range for variable speed capacity control
  • Low NPSHR and robust to vapour bubbles in inlet
  • Installation and service friendly
  • Compact and low weight.

Grundfos NB, NBG, NBE, NBGE

Posted by on Wednesday, 22 April, 2015

Grundfos end-suction pumps are used in water supply, industrial pressure boosting, industrial liquid transfer, HVAC (heating, ventilation and air-conditioning), and irrigation.

 
Grundfos end-suction pumps are multi-purpose pumps suitable for a variety of different applications requiring reliable and cost-efficient supply. End-suction pumps are used in five main areas of application: water supply, industrial pressure boosting, industrial liquid transfer, HVAC and irrigation.

 

 
The Grundfos NB/NBG pumps are all non-self-priming, single-stage, centrifugal volute pumps with axial suction port, radial discharge port and horizontal shaft. The NB/NBG range consists of close-coupled pumps with their main dimensions in accordance with either EN733 or ISO2858.

Applications

Grundfos offers a virtually limitless range of close coupled (NB) end-suction pumps. Their sturdiness and reliability make them ideal for use in demanding environments such as the following:

  • District heating plants
  • Heating systems for blocks of flats
  • Air-conditioning systems
  • Cooling systems
  • Wash down systems
  • Other industrial systems.

 

Features and benefits

  • Optimised hydraulics in housing and impeller = unimpeded liquid flow
  • O-ring seal between pump housing and cover = no risk of leakage
  • Housing, impeller and wear ring in different materials = improved corrosion resistance, no sticking elements
  • Pump is CED coated to increase corrosion resistance
  • Available with IE1, IE2 and IE3 motors
  • Available in a number of shaft seal and material variants
  • PN 10,16 and 25 bar
  • For temperatures up to 140 °C.

Grundfos Euro-HYGIA®

Posted by on Wednesday, 22 April, 2015

The single-stage, end-suction centrifugal stainless steel pumps of the premium Euro-HYGIA® range are designed for use in industries where hygiene and flexibility are a top priority. They are made from high quality materials to meet the world’s strictest hygiene standards, e.g. EHEDG, QHD and GOST.

 

However, their most distinctive feature is their flexibility. The Euro-HYGIA® pumps can be adapted to suit any task where reliable, hygienic pumping is required. The pumps are CIP- and SIP-capable, and they also meet the GMP requirements regarding FDA-approved materials.

 

 

The main applications are in breweries, the beverage and food industries and the pharmaceutical industry. Thanks to their flexibility, the Euro-HYGIA® pumps can also be used successfully in all other industrial processes, including water treatment, chemical processes, surface treatment and textile industry processes.

Applications

  • Liquid transfer in breweries and dairies
  • Soft-drink mixing
  • Food processing
  • Pure water systems (WFI)
  • Process pumping in the pharmaceutical industry
  • CIP (Cleaning-In-Place) systems
  • Process pumping in the chemical industry
  • Transfer and circulation pump in water treatment systems and textile treatment systems
  • Nearly all kinds of transfer, circulating and process pumping.

 

Features and benefits

  • Unique hygienic design
  • Simple maintenance – less downtime
  • CIP and SIP capable (DIN EN 12462)
  • Greatest possible flexibility – customised solutions
  • Materials: Rolled, deep-drawn steel AISI 316L (1.4404/1.4435) with electropolished surface
  • Gentle liquid handling for sensitive liquids such as fruit juice
  • Optimised hydraulics
  • Various motors, including high efficiency motors
  • Multiple sealing systems
  • Wide range of pump variants
  • Shrouded pumps, especially useful for breweries and dairies
  • Various pipe connection types and sizes
  • Three different impeller types
  • Robust design for heavy duty operation
  • High efficiency and low energy consumption
  • Trolley-mounted version available
  • ATEX-certified pumps

Grundfos HS

Posted by on Tuesday, 21 April, 2015

The Grundfos HS horizontal split case pump is a single-stage, non-self-priming, between bearing, centrifugal volute pump. The axially split design allows easy removal of the top casing and access to the pump components (bearings, wear rings, impeller, and shaft seal) without disturbing the motor or pipework.

The independent bearing housing allows for ease of maintenance without removing the top casing. The double volute design reduces the radial load on the shaft, extending component life, minimising vibration and providing quiet operation.

 

Grundfos HS

 

The HS pump also offers high pump efficiencies throughout the range.  High energy efficiency along with long pump life and easy maintenance add up to low life-cycle costs.

 

 

 

 

The HS pump is available in three configurations – pump with motor and baseframe, pump with baseframe, and bare shaft pump only.

The HS pump is ideal for custom applications and is available in a wide range of variants. The high efficiency and low life cycle costs make the HS ideal for any commercial building, water utility or industrial project.

Applications

Grundfos HS horizontal split case pumps are typically used in these applications:

  • Air-conditioning/heating systems
  • Public water supply
  • District cooling/heating plants
  • Cooling systems
  • Public waterworks
  • Process cooling
  • Irrigation.

Features and benefits

  • Easy to service: split case design
  • Double suction minimises axial load,which extends the life of the wear rings, shaft seals and bearings
  • Double volute reduces radial forces and minimises noise and vibration
  • Independent bearing housing design allows access to the pump components without removing the top half of the casing
  • High energy efficiency
  • Low life-cycle costs
  • Many product variants available.

Grundfos DWK

Posted by on Tuesday, 21 April, 2015

DWK and DPK are submersible pumps designed for dewatering and drainage applications. The cast-iron construction and the hydraulic design contribute durability and high efficiency. The differences between the DWK and DPK pump ranges lie in the discharge arrangement and the installation type. The DWK is designed with a top discharge pipe and suction strainer, and is thus more suitable for temporary installation, whereas the DPK has a side discharge and a ring-stand or auto coupling (as accessories), and is suitable for permanent installations.

 

 

 

 

 

 

Applications

DWK/DPK are excellent pumps for dewatering and draining applications. The combination of compact design with high-pressure capability makes the pumps suitable for use in pits, whether for temporary or fixed installation. The installation design options provide the flexibility needed to cover many needs. Applications include:

  • Construction sites
  • Excavations
  • Tunnels
  • Fish ponds
  • Drainage pits.

Features and benefits

  • Durability
  • High efficiency
  • Installation flexibility
  • High-pressure capabilities, cost-effectiveness.

Grundfos CMV

Posted by on Monday, 20 April, 2015

The vertical, multistage CMV pump has been developed with compactness and modularity as two of its central features, enabling numerous customised solutions. The pump basically consists of a series of interchangeable modules, all of which have been designed to work together seamlessly, no matter the application.

The pumps are of the close-coupled type, with a mechanical shaft seal.

 

The CMV pumps are available with cast-iron base and discharge part whereas the remaining wetted parts are made of stainless steel (AISI 304/DIN 1.4301).

 

 

Applications

While each Grundfos CMV pump can be customised to meet individual requirements, the pump family is designed to be used in a wide variety of applications.

These include

  • Pressure-boosting systems
  • Domestic water supply systems
  • Cooling systems
  • Air-conditioning systems
  • Horticultural irrigation systems
  • Small industrial applications.

 

Features and benefits

  • Compact design
  • Modular design/customised solutions
  • High reliability
  • Low noise level
  • High-performance hydraulics
  • Grundfos motor

Grundfos SEG

Posted by on Monday, 20 April, 2015

The SEG range of grinder pumps from Grundfos is specifically designed for pumping effluent and untreated sewage in small communities or sparsely populated areas with no sewer systems or where gravitation systems are unsuitable.

Pressurised systems are the perfect choice for transfer of effluent and sewage, and the SEG range combines cost-effectiveness with maximum protection for the environment by facilitating the use of smaller pressure pipes for minimal investment costs.

 

 

The SEG range is designed to reduce energy consumption and to keep downtime costs to a minimum, while maintaining peak performance throughout the system life.

Applications

The Grundfos SEG pumps are specifically designed for pumping untreated wastewater from domestic, commercial or municipal sources. The high discharge pressure enables transfer of wastewater over longer distances.

Features and benefits

  • Cable plug connection
  • Efficient grinder system
  • SmartTrim impeller adjustment
  • Unique clamp connection
  • Specially designed lifting handle
  • Unique cartridge shaft seal
  • Modular design
  • Heavy-duty ball bearings.

Grundfos Unilift KP

Posted by on Sunday, 19 April, 2015

Unilift KP pumps are submersible drainage pumps suitable for both temporary and permanent free-standing installation. They can be used for pumping drain water or grey wastewater. They are also suitable for installation in collecting tanks.

 

 

 

 

 

 

The Unilift KP is a single-stage drainage pump with semi-open impeller, designed for the pumping of drain water and grey wastewater. All Unilift KP pumps can be supplied with or without a level switch. The variants are designated as A, AV or M, for automatic or manual operation. The Unilift KP-AV variant for narrow pits is supplied with a non-return flap valve for installation in the outlet. The strainer is clipped onto the pump housing.

The Unilift KP. Single-stage, submersible, stainless steel drainage pump in a robust design with upward-pointing discharge port positioned on the top of the pump.The outer casing is made in one piece. The mains cable and the cable of the level switch are both connected to a single, vulcanized, water-tight plug which is inserted in a socket on the hermetically-sealed stator housing. The motor is a single- or three-phase synchronous canned motor with liquid-filled rotor chamber and water-lubricated bearings.

The motor is cooled by the pumped liquid flowing around it.

  • Enclosure class: IP 68
  • Insulation class: F

The motor incorporates automatic overload protection which cuts out the motor in the event of overload. When it has cooled to normal temperature, the motor restarts automatically.

Applications

The Grundfos Unilift KP pumps are designed for the pumping of:

  • Water and rainwater in horticulture
  • Water from rivers and lakes
  • Rainwater, drainage water and water from flooding
  • Water for filling/emptying containers, ponds, tanks, etc.
  • Effluents from showers, washing machines and sinks below sewer level
  • Pool water
  • Ditch drainage water
  • Groundwater (lowering applications)
  • Domestic effluents from septic and sludge-treating systems
  • Effluents from viaducts, underpasses, etc.
  • Drainage water from garage sprinkler systems.

Grundfos SB

Posted by on Sunday, 19 April, 2015

The SB pump is a submersible booster pump for the pumping of clean water. It is especially suitable for rainwater applications. The pump is available in two main versions:

  • with integrated suction strainer (1 mm mesh)
  • with side inlet which includes a flexible suction hose with floating suction strainer (1 mm mesh).

 

 

 

 

 

 

In both versions, the pump is available with or without float switch. The float switch can be used for automatic operation or dry-running protection of the pump.

Applications

The SB pump is a submersible booster pump for the pumping of clean water. It is especially suitable for rainwater applications.

Features and benefits

  • Noiseless operation
  • High reliability
  • Integrated protection.
